Why Lithium Battery Disposal Matters Now
With global energy storage capacity projected to reach 1.2 TWh by 2030 (BloombergNEF), used lithium-ion batteries from solar/wind projects could create 11 million metric tons of waste annually. Improper disposal risks:
- Soil/water contamination from heavy metals
- Fire hazards due to residual charge
- Wasted valuable materials like cobalt and lithium
The Recycling Gap: Current Industry Reality
Despite growing awareness, only 5% of lithium batteries are currently recycled globally. Compare this with lead-acid batteries' 99% recycling rate. Our analysis reveals three key bottlenecks:
Challenge | Impact | Solution Trend |
---|---|---|
High processing costs | $4-6/kg vs. $1/kg for new materials | Automated sorting systems |
Safety risks | 30% of storage fires linked to damaged cells | Pre-discharge protocols |
Logistics complexity | 60% cost in transportation | Regional collection hubs |
Proven Disposal Methods for Energy Storage Systems
Let's break down the four most viable options:
1. Pyrometallurgical Recovery
Using high-temperature smelting (1,400°C+), this method recovers:
- 90-95% of cobalt/nickel
- 50-60% lithium
"While energy-intensive, it handles mixed battery chemistries effectively." – Battery Recycling Weekly
2. Hydrometallurgical Process
Chemical leaching solutions achieve:
- Higher lithium recovery (80-85%)
- Lower CO₂ emissions vs. pyrometallurgy
Real case: A German recycler using this method achieved 93% material purity for reuse in new EV batteries.
Emerging Innovations to Watch
The industry isn't standing still. Two breakthrough approaches are gaining traction:
Direct Cathode Regeneration
Instead of breaking down materials, this repairs existing cathode structures. Early tests show:
- 40% cost reduction vs traditional methods
- 95% performance retention
AI-Powered Sorting Systems
Machine learning algorithms now identify battery types 20x faster than manual sorting. One California facility increased processing capacity by 300% after implementation.
Global Regulatory Landscape
Governments are tightening rules – and opportunities:
- EU: Mandates 70% recycling efficiency by 2030
- California: $150/ton subsidy for certified recyclers
- China: Banned landfill disposal since 2022

FAQ: Lithium Battery Disposal
Q: How long can stored batteries wait before recycling?
A: Ideally under 6 months. Beyond 1 year, degradation increases processing costs by 15-20%.
Q: Are all lithium batteries recyclable?
A> Most are, but pouch cells require specialized handling. Always consult certified recyclers.
